Iranian Foreign Minister Condemns Attacks on Civilian Infrastructure

Tehran. Iranian Foreign Minister Abbas Araghchi has stated that attacks on civilian infrastructure will not force the Iranian people to surrender. Responding via the social media platform 'X', he remarked that such attacks only demonstrate the defeat and moral bankruptcy of a disorganized enemy.

Referring to the airstrike on a bridge under construction in Karaj, he stated that such actions do not constitute military success but merely send a negative message. He further claimed that this causes irreparable damage to the international image of the United States.

Araghchi also responded in another post to US President Donald Trump's warning that he would return Iran to the Stone Age.

 'At that time, oil and gas were not being produced in West Asia,' he questioned, adding– 'Do the American President and the citizens who voted for him truly want to turn back time?'
